Ventura Village Apartments
Apartment Buildings
Apartment Buildings
Name :Ventura Village Apartments
Type :Apartment Buildings
Address :9605 Jacobi Avenue Saint Louis MO 63136
Phone :(314)868-8220
Fax :–
email :–
Website :www.apartmentguide.com/Property/property.asp?wsv_psPropertyID=5975&partner=6223
Country :Saint Louis
FIPS :29189
Time Zone :CST
Longtitude :-90.2608
Latitude :38.7423
Maps of Ventura Village Apartments